Filled with former NFL players, Detroit Lions coaching staff 'knows what it takes' to win

DETROIT -- For Jared Goff, this offseason has been different for a number of reasons.

For starters, the California native is now quarterback of the Detroit Lions after five seasons with the Los Angeles Rams.

Then, when he glanced around the Lions’ practice facility during OTAs, he noticed a uniqueness from the coaches on the sideline directing the action -- they are all former NFL players.

“It’s been interesting. I’ve had former players coach me in the past, but never this many,” Goff said. “It’s cool. It’s fun. A guy like [Antwaan] Randle El, he played at a high level for a long time and knows what he’s talking about and the same way for everyone else.
